The CEOP button sends the details to CEOP - who are a branch of SOCA (Serious and Organised Crime Agency), who have police powers.

I sent them info a year or 2 ago (relatively minor but still worth investigating), and I was contacted by the local police a month or so later saying they'd tracked the person down and officers would be going to have a word with them.

 

So I reckon it works, and I think a button to pass details onto the police/FBI/whatever is a good idea - not many websites take that much action, and jail is a much better deterrent than the sanctions a company has at it's disposal.
